Our office in Kingston, ON, is looking for a Site Environmental Health and Safety Coordinator to support its project site in Napanee, ON, for a period of approximately twelve months.
**Summary of the Role**:
Reporting to the Area Manager and the Corporate Environmental Health and Safety Manager, the Environmental Health and Safety Coordinator will be responsible for implementing, monitoring and enforcing the company health and safety policies and programs, while ensuring safe working procedures on company work sites, facilities and regulatory compliance.
**Key Responsibilities**:
- Implement and oversee the site safety program through continuous on-site monitoring during field execution.
- Liaise with management and workers to ensure that the highest level of due diligence is maintained.
- Provide counsel and advice on project management on all health and safety related matters.
- Coordinate and attend on-site health and safety meetings.
- Provide site health and safety training, indoctrination, orientation to employees.
- Provide WHMIS training.
- May chair or co-chair health & safety committee.
- Thoroughly investigate lost time accident/incident and health and safety related complaints.
- Generate H&S statistics and provide regular reports in a prescribed format, to the Environmental Health and Safety Manager.
- Perform daily observations of our project sites and assist site supervision to ensure all work activities are done safely and within legislative requirements.
- Perform weekly documented site inspections and monthly safety audits
- Maintain daily/weekly/monthly work activity logbooks.
- Maintain records of all safety and site information used to provide statistics, charts, reports etc.
- Ensure management remains aware of any potential H&S related issues that may negatively impact the business.
- Work with management and employees to develop and implement appropriate return to work and modified work programs.
- Maintain zero tolerance for on-the-job safety infractions.
- Ensure responsibilities and accountabilities are carried out in a safe manner in accordance with E.S. Fox Limited Environmental Health and Safety Management Program and OHSA requirements.
- Ensure that environmental aspects within their sphere of responsibility are adhered to pursuant to ISO 14001 requirements.
**Key Requirements, Experience and Skills**:
- Post secondary education (Degree in Management or Occupational Health & Safety) is recommended.
- CSAO certification by the Province of Ontario.
- CRSP (Canadian Registered Safety Professional) designation preferred.
- Certified H&S trainer.
- Current knowledge of OHSA, WSIB, Construction and Industrial Safety Regulations.
- Current CPR and First Aid training certification.
- WHMIS, Fall Protection/Arrest, Lock out, Confined Space, TDG training.
- 5 - 10 years direct Safety supervisory experience.
- Practical experience in construction site Health & Safety.
- Experience in developing and monitoring modified work or light duty programs.
- Demonstrated experience in working with WSIB adjudicators.
- Strong communication skills, both written and verbal.
